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Dalston Junction to Gleneagles start from as little as £44.30

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Dalston Junction to Gleneagles start from £101.10 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Dalston Junction to Gleneagles are available for £217.20 one way

Facilities and Amenities at Dalston Junction Station

Dalston Junction station is well-equipped with ticket machines and accessible ticket machines, making ticket purchasing quick and convenient. Although the ticket office is only open during limited hours, from 07:30 to 10:00 on weekdays and 12:30 to 14:45 on Saturdays, you can collect pre-purchased tickets from machines at any time. If you require assistance or information, staff at Dalston Junction are ready to help, and you can also rely on information displayed on screens for departure and arrival updates.

Accessibility is a top priority at Dalston Junction, with step-free access throughout the station and lift access to all platforms. Moreover, facilities such as induction loops, ramps for train access, and accessible toilets are available, ensuring that everyone can travel comfortably and confidently.

Connecting the City: Transport Links from Dalston Junction

Getting around from Dalston Junction is a breeze, thanks to local bus services and rail replacement services. Use bus stop M in Kingsland High Street for southbound services to New Cross and New Cross Gate, or bus stop L for northbound services to Dalston Kingsland. While there are no dedicated cycle hire facilities, you will find cycle storage racks at the station with around 15 spaces, sheltered to protect from the elements and under CCTV surveillance for added security.

Station Facilities and Services

Although Gleneagles station does not have a staffed ticket office, travelers can easily collect pre-purchased tickets from the available ticket machines, which are also accessible for passengers with disabilities. The station takes pride in inclusivity, offering step-free access throughout. While you won't find shops or refreshment facilities on-site, the station ensures a comfortable wait with seating areas. Travelers are supported with public Wi-Fi, making it convenient for both business travelers and leisure passengers to stay connected. For any additional information or assistance, help points are strategically placed within the station, ensuring your questions are always answered.

Onward Travel Options

Gleneagles Station is well-equipped to get you to your onward destinations with ease. Taxis can be arranged via traintaxi.co.uk, offering convenient access to nearby attractions or accommodations. For those relying on bus services, the bus stop at the station's entrance connects travelers to various local routes. You can plan your journey through Traveline Scotland to access real-time bus schedules and route maps. If a rail replacement bus service is needed, you'll find it waiting at the front of the station.
